| How to obtain INS
Form I-20 from outside the United States? |
To receive the I-20 form,
you must complete the following forms accurately:
and return them to the International Student Office with the required
documents. PLEASE NOTE:
Acceptable documents must be submitted two weeks in advance of issuance
of INS Form I-20.
| DEADLINES: |
| FOR SEMESTER: |
BY: |
| Spring |
November 30 |
| Fall |
June 30 |
** Unacceptable documents will be rejected and returned to you. Papers
must be completed exactly as the rules below require. Nearly half
of the documents we receive are unsatisfactory because students or
sponsors ignore the rules. Please read the rules carefully. |
Why
do I need to prove financial ability? |
|
Your visa is only your travel
document. It does not give you permission to enter the U.S. When your
visa is issued, the embassy or consulate will return INS Form I-20
to you in a sealed envelope, which is to be presented to the U.S.
Immigration at the port of entry to the U.S.
The permission to enter the U.S. is given at the port of entry on
a document known as I-94, a small white card stapled into your passport.
The Immigration Inspector will stamp your I-20, take pages one and
two, and return pages three and four to you. DO NOT LOSE YOUR PORTION
OF INS FORM I-20. It is a very important document. |
